About Converting Decigrams per Teaspoon to Decagrams per Fluid ounce

Decigram per Teaspoon and Decagram per Fluid ounce both measure density — mass per unit volume — a property used to identify materials, check manufacturing quality, and predict whether something floats or sinks. As a fixed reference point, water has a density of exactly 1000 kg/m³ (1 g/cm³, 1 g/mL) at its temperature of maximum density, which is why many density figures in science and engineering are quoted relative to water. Both are mass per volume density units.

Formula

decagrams per fluid ounce = decigrams per teaspoon × 0.06

This factor comes from each unit's defined relationship to the category's base unit: 1 decigram per teaspoon equals 20.2884136211 base units, and 1 decagram per fluid ounce equals 338.140227018 base units, so dividing one by the other gives the direct decigram per teaspoon-to-decagram per fluid ounce factor of 0.06.

What's the difference between density and mass concentration?

Density is the mass of a pure substance or material per unit volume. Mass concentration is the mass of one component — like a dissolved solute — within a mixture's total volume. The two use the same kind of units but describe different physical situations.
